What companies run services between Nashik, India and Nerul, Mahārāshtra, India?

Indian Railways operates a train from Nasik Road to Thane hourly. Tickets cost ₹160–1,548 and the journey takes 2h 52m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Nashik, Maharashtra to Uran Phata via Kalyan, Maharashtra and Kalyan station in around 4h 31m.
